Essential Functions:

  • Recruit, manage, and develop Finance staff.
  • Complete annual performance appraisals in accordance with HR guidelines.
  • Maintain written policies of all procedures to adhere to PPFA Elements of Performance (EOPs), audit standards, internal control standards, family council statutory requirements, and internal/external reporting requirements.
  • Maintain banking and investment relationships for routine services, resource management, asset transfers, and lines of credit.
  • Review/approve weekly payables batches and initiate related wire transfers, and ensure accurate posting of all subledgers to the general ledger.
  • Ensure that all centers are properly adhering to procedures around cash handling and reporting, including but not limited to: signature requirements, deposit verifications, and petty cash procedures.
  • Assist CFO with the management of agency cash flow by monitoring the timing of expenditures and lines of credit; reconcile cash transactions in Practice Management and Fundraising systems.
  • Review, approve, and post journal entries prepared by the Financial Analyst/Sr. Accountant.
  • Oversee regular review of the general ledger. This includes account reconciliations, general ledger structure and maintenance, and regular review of accounts to assure accuracy and detect/correct anomalies.
  • Prepare agency financial statements that are timely and accurate for both internal and external stakeholders.
  • Ensure compliance with financial management restrictions of funders and proper accounting treatment of restricted contributions.
  • Assist the CFO in leading the annual budget preparation.
  • Coordinate annual audits and agreed-upon procedures, ensuring on-time completion and delivery.
  • Prepare reporting to external agencies that is timely and accurate.
  • Oversee and coordinate quarterly CRQM audits.
  • Ensure timely and accurate tax filings are completed.
  • Communicate with the Director of Center Operations/Director of Health Services & Systems to communicate issues identified in various reconciliation processes for training and follow-up with centers and personnel.
  • Participate in interdepartmental, interdisciplinary teams to improve and integrate centralized and distributed financial operations, with special attention to technical assistance and oversight of health centers. Alert the CFO as variances or issues arise.
  • Serve as an Ambassador for the organization to inspire support and connection with the mission and services provided by the affiliate.
  • Adhere to all HIPAA and patient privacy regulations.
  • Other duties as assigned by the Chief Financial Officer.
